Restaurante El Vasco lies close to the Centre of Vila-Real, a small town to the south of Catellon de la Plana and 40 minutes drive north of Valencia, about 5km inland from the coast and about half way up the east side of Spain ! You would never find it or know about it unless you were a local, it is in a very unassuming building on a side street, just out from the centre of town. A very modest sign above the entrance announces its presence, in a residential building that almost hides it from view. You cannot just walk in, but have to press a buzzer to be let in and you then walk past football memorabilia intermixed with more conventional Restaurant fixtures and fittings. The restaurant is quite small with a generous kitchen that you can see into as you go past. It feels very local and understated. However, the food was simply stunning and of an exceptionally high quality, with a wide range of simple yet creative local dishes brought to our table (this was a business lunch). They use the finest ingredient to creat a series of sublime courses that complimented each other beautifully. The Jamon de Jabugo was delicious with and ice cold beer to go with the tomato bread, the Benito Ihintza so delicate that it melted in your mouth, the 80 day hung beef, cooked by your own fair hand at your table on a sizzling and very hot earthenware platter was sublime.... the dishes kept coming until we ran out of time and had to surrender, and ask for a Cortado coffee to finish (the best coffee that I have had in a long time). It was such a surprise, unpretentious and the staff were extremely helpful and made the lunch feel far more personal and special. They all spoke English which helped. This is well worth hunting for, even if a little difficult to find with not much else around it.... but I would highly recommend it and suggest considering the trip even if you are staying in Valencia.... It would be great for a business lunch (this region is the centre of porcelain manufacturing in Spain), great for family and friends.... not very romantic given the wider setting, but worth a try just for the delicious food.

We had lunch here when we visited Vila Real to watch a match at El Madrigal stadium. We were immediately impressed by the ambience of the restaurant, helped along by seeing a framed signed Contador shirt in the hallway (Spain 's most famous pro cyclist, for those who don 't follow the sport). There was no menu offered, which initially threw us into a spin, as we are not meat eaters and speak little or no Spanish. Although the first plate proffered was very meaty, this wasn 't a problem, as we were able to make ourselves understood and a non meaty alternative was offered. Our main courses were 2 types of fish, and this was absolutely delicious. We hadn 't intended to have starters and desserts, but found ourselves saying 'yes please, and muy bien ' as the food was too good to resist. For what we had three courses with drinks it was reasonably priced, although not cheap. But we were very happy, and will return if we find ourselves again in Vila Real.
